Output c59cbe8066a850c8041a2b8bf88e5c78b87c8e3d2471be8d8871cb9477c95817:0

value
125080323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f8a974c520fcab51b02b5a25ea50d0b21427c5 OP_EQUAL
address
32WTDQtiixpqJRqxdJ7BhjeKp7D3gEuUMc
transaction
c59cbe8066a850c8041a2b8bf88e5c78b87c8e3d2471be8d8871cb9477c95817
spent
true